5 EDGE prospects to replace Myles Garrett in the NFL draft

February 10, 2025 by Browns Wire

https://player.anyclip.com/anyclip-widget/lre-widget/prod/v1/src/lre.js

Franchise star defensive end Myles Garrett has requested a trade from the Cleveland Browns, so that may be another need the team has to address in the 2025 NFL draft.

Garrett began soft-launching the trade request after January’s final Browns game. The Browns front office have emphatically rejected moving him all off-season. The trade request adds another fire under the seat of general manager Andrew Berry. Berry will be drafting for his job this off-season.

There’s no way a team can draft a replacement for an NFL Defensive Player of the Year award winner in his prime. They’re far too talented and impactful to find a replacement, even at the top of the draft.

The best-case scenario is replicating the Los Angeles Rams method. They used their first and second-round pick on college teammates Jared Verse and Brenden Fiske to replace Aaron Donald this offseason. The two rookies had a lot of success rushing the passer this season. Verse was named NFL Defensive Rookie of the Year.
